Your three sessions.

Each session develops a different part of the process, taking you from prepared clay to finished, glazed work.

Session 01

Centre and throw

Learn to centre clay, open the form and pull the walls to create bowls, cups and other simple wheel thrown shapes.

Session 02

Trim and decorate

Refine your pieces by trimming the bases, attaching handles and trying carving and surface decoration.

Session 03

Glaze your work

Prepare and glaze your pieces using NewMakeIt's in house glaze selection before their final firing.
